As a former PTC Board of Governors President and Chair and current PTC Academy instructor, I do my best to be a steadfast ambassador for the council. I’m advocating for all telecom professionals doing business in the Pacific Rim to attend PTC’22: Reunite. Rethink. Renew. in Honolulu from 16 to 19 January 2022.

If you register by 1 November, you’ll enjoy the current best available discounted rates. The theme of the conference is Reunite. Rethink. Renew. – ideal spotlights for this hybrid (in person and virtual) event.

Enabling technologies are critical to the trajectory of our industry. Expect to learn more about the innovations of edge, cloud, blockchain, and big data. Regulatory sessions also are relevant as policies evolve. It’s important to keep up with digital infrastructure, data collection, privacy, security, universal service, climate, energy, and carbon. And don’t forget the Sunday submarine cable sessions.

There will be so many topics to explore. Whether you are a senior executive or an emerging professional, you will gain valuable insight at PTC’22, plus an extraordinary opportunity to network with some of the finest minds in our ecosystem.

We’re counting down the days to the start of PTC’22. There’s no better way to start the new year. I look forward to seeing everyone in Honolulu in January. Until then, aloha!
